首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

了解NGINX默认缓存

NGINX是一款高性能的开源Web服务器和反向代理服务器。默认缓存是NGINX的一项功能,它可以帮助提高网站的性能和响应速度。

默认缓存是指NGINX在接收到客户端请求后,将请求的响应内容缓存起来,并在后续相同请求到达时直接返回缓存的响应,而不需要再次访问后端服务器。这样可以减轻后端服务器的负载,提高网站的性能和吞吐量。

NGINX的默认缓存可以通过配置文件进行设置。以下是一些常用的配置选项:

  1. proxy_cache_path:指定缓存文件的存储路径。
  2. proxy_cache:启用或禁用缓存功能。
  3. proxy_cache_valid:设置缓存的有效期。
  4. proxy_cache_key:设置缓存的键值,用于唯一标识不同的请求。

NGINX的默认缓存适用于静态内容或者对实时性要求不高的动态内容。它可以减少对后端服务器的请求次数,提高网站的响应速度,并且可以通过设置缓存的有效期来控制缓存内容的更新频率。

对于静态资源,如图片、CSS和JavaScript文件,可以将其缓存时间设置较长,以减少对后端服务器的请求。而对于动态内容,如动态生成的HTML页面,可以根据业务需求设置较短的缓存时间,以保证内容的实时性。

腾讯云提供了一款云服务器CVM,可以搭建NGINX服务器并配置默认缓存。您可以通过腾讯云云服务器产品页面(https://cloud.tencent.com/product/cvm)了解更多详情,并进行相关的购买和配置操作。

总结起来,NGINX的默认缓存是一项提高网站性能和响应速度的功能,适用于静态内容或对实时性要求不高的动态内容。通过合理配置缓存参数,可以减少对后端服务器的请求,提高网站的吞吐量。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

3分59秒

114-nginx内存缓存介绍

4分50秒

115-nginx外置缓存介绍

3分50秒

47-线上实战-修改Nginx默认页

8分24秒

08-基本使用-Nginx的目录结构 在线编辑默认页

10分7秒

116-应用缓存与多级缓存整体结构

14分52秒

099-浏览器的强制缓存与协商缓存

7分24秒

074-一些默认有用的header

20分33秒

097-什么是多级缓存

6分17秒

109-缓存清理插件编译安装

19分32秒

110-cache_key 与缓存清理

21分4秒

108-反向代理缓存proxy_cache配置

20分1秒

117-使用strace追踪内核对sendfile缓存调优

领券